Join us atour new scheme, Bridgewell, a warm and welcoming supported living service where we support adults with learning disabilities and social care needs. Our dedicated team provides 24-hour, person-centred care tailored to each individual’s unique needs.
We are looking for compassionate, confident, and capable Assistant Support Worker’s to become part of our close-knit team. In this rewarding role, you will help with personal care, medication, health appointments, cooking, cleaning, shopping, and community engagement. You will also be a calm and reliable presence in emergency situations, ensuring the safety and wellbeing of those we support.
